Output 20dd3f0ff05ad2e3c3618edda1565156c772ae9509d96d4ab0a231054cf523cc:1

value
43715460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f37bf3cf4f8a239a72dbc72f366b60e8d4f205d OP_EQUALVERIFY OP_CHECKSIG
address
15JfYPTPJuPpqeJBeTvo3ZFG3W9MvVC8bq
transaction
20dd3f0ff05ad2e3c3618edda1565156c772ae9509d96d4ab0a231054cf523cc
confirmations
284960
spent
true